About the team

Nectar360 is one of the most dynamic and fast‑growing areas of our business. As part of the Commercial Finance team supporting Marketing & Loyalty, you’ll join a collaborative, commercially minded environment that partners closely with stakeholders across a broad portfolio of over 700 FMCG and GM brands. 

Nectar360 specialises in loyalty, customer insight, and marketing solutions—helping brands understand customers as well as we do. You’ll be part of a team that plays a vital role in shaping growth, providing trusted financial expertise and supporting decisions that drive meaningful performance improvements. 

 

More about the role

As Finance Manager for Nectar360, you will act as a strategic business partner to the commercial teams, providing analysis, insight and financial recommendations that drive improved outcomes across revenue, income, ROI and cost performance. You’ll help shape the 5-year plan, support in‑year budgeting and forecasting, and interpret management reporting to guide stakeholders with clear and actionable commentary.

The role business partners one of the three key pillars of the Nectar360 business supporting our growing Nectar coalition scheme which is the UK’s largest and most engaged with (including Sainsbury’s, Argos, Esso, Amex, Avios and Marriott). You will be building business cases, supporting post-implementation reviews, identifying risks and opportunities, and performing bespoke financial analysis to support projects or new business opportunities. 

You’ll work cross-functionally with Marketing, Analytics, Digital and Tech teams, and contribute to the continuous simplification of how we operate—streamlining processes and enhancing ways of working.

About Sainsbury's

Over 150 years old and still going strong, we’re the UK’s second-biggest retailer. Every day, the nation shops with us because they know they’ll get affordable, good food and excellent service.

We focus on great value and convenient shopping across our family of brands, from Argos, Nectar and Habitat to Sainsbury’s Bank, Smart Charge and Tu.

What’s next for Sainsbury’s?

We've put food back at the heart of our business and we’re taking Sainsbury’s to the next level. We’re investing in technology and people and we’re thinking bigger about how we attract and connect with our customers, while doing everything we can to create a more resilient UK food system.
